Chocolate jumbles with caramel icing are a delightful treat that combines the rich flavor of cocoa with the spicy warmth of cinnamon and ginger, all topped with a luscious caramel icing. This recipe is perfect for anyone looking to create a tasty, sweet, and slightly spiced indulgence. Follow these steps to create your own batch of delicious chocolate jumbles.
- Ensure your butter is at room temperature for easier mixing.
- Sift your dry ingredients like flour, cocoa powder, and spices to avoid lumps and to ensure even mixing.
- Use a stand mixer or hand mixer to blend the butter and sugar until light and fluffy, which helps in creating a better texture.
- Chill the dough for at least 30 minutes before baking to prevent the cookies from spreading too much.
- Pipe or spread the caramel icing while the jumbles are still slightly warm to help it adhere better.
